diff --git a/docker-compose-dev.yaml b/docker-compose-dev.yaml index 61d4376bbf..a4c34d9be7 100644 --- a/docker-compose-dev.yaml +++ b/docker-compose-dev.yaml @@ -12,7 +12,7 @@ services: ports: - 5432:5432 volumes: - - hyperion_db_data:/var/lib/postgresql/data + - postgres_data_dev:/var/lib/postgresql/data hyperion-redis: image: redis @@ -20,6 +20,9 @@ services: restart: unless-stopped ports: - 6379:6379 + volumes: + - redis_data_dev:/data volumes: - hyperion_db_data: + postgres_data_dev: + redis_data_dev: diff --git a/docker-compose.yaml b/docker-compose.yaml index f78b1a8d86..e0a51362f1 100644 --- a/docker-compose.yaml +++ b/docker-compose.yaml @@ -14,7 +14,7 @@ services: POSTGRES_DB: ${POSTGRES_DB} PGTZ: ${POSTGRES_TZ} volumes: - - ./hyperion_db_data:/var/lib/postgresql/data:Z + - postgres_data:/var/lib/postgresql/data hyperion-redis: image: redis @@ -23,6 +23,8 @@ services: command: redis-server --requirepass ${REDIS_PASSWORD} environment: - REDIS_PASSWORD=${REDIS_PASSWORD} + volumes: + - redis_data:/data hyperion-app: image: hyperion-app @@ -36,7 +38,12 @@ services: ports: - 8000:8000 volumes: - - ./logs:/app/logs:Z - - ./data:/app/data:Z - - ./.env:/app/.env:Z - - ./firebase.json:/app/firebase.json:Z + - app_logs:/hyperion/logs + - app_data:/hyperion/data + - ./.env:/hyperion/.env + +volumes: + postgres_data: + redis_data: + app_data: + app_logs: